A forecasted term for the specific low, restless feeling a fan gets when they've gone too long without new content or updates from their favorite idol or character β genuinely resembling withdrawal rather than ordinary impatience.
REAL-WORLD EXAMPLE
"No content from her in two weeks and I am fully oshisick, refreshing every tag hoping for anything new."
LORE & ORIGIN
A predictive term blending 'oshi' (favorite) with 'sick,' anticipating a name for this specific attachment-withdrawal feeling as parasocial idol culture became widespread enough to need vocabulary for its lulls, not just its highs.
